I could be mistaken, but I don't think that TC made a wood stock for that model.
First check with them to see if they or their custom shop at Fox Ridge Outfitters ever made any for it.
TC Customer Service 603-332-2333
Fox Ridge 800-243-4570 (I don't know if this number is current or not)

You just might need a minor miracle to find any after market stock for it.
That means you'll either need to hire a stockmaker to carve or duplicate a customized stock or do it yourself. A hobbyist might offer the most reasonable price depending on the cost of the wood or [pre-shaped] blank.
Laminated wood may be a better choice but it's certainly more difficult to carve.
The whole idea sounds like it would be an expensive proposition. :)
 
Laminated wood is certainly stronger than regular wood, but it sure eats up the Nicholson #49 or #50 files (both used regularly by stockmakers). It's the darn epoxies that wear them out.

There's plenty of blackpowder gunbuilders out there. Perhaps you can convince one of them to make a stock for you. It's easier than making a long rifle stock.

You can send the plastic one to one of many stockmakers and they'll do a 90% finished stock. Final inletting and finishing are a bit of a pain, but nothing like shaping a stock from a piece of hardwood!
